Welcome to the 极乐禁地e Poetry Coalition.

We are a group of MCs, page-poets, and spoken-word artists who have come together to support the establishment of a 极乐禁地e Poet Laureate, and to lift up versifying and the literary arts, more generally. 

The Coalition builds on 极乐禁地e traditions鈥攍ike Poetry for the People, organized by Olu Butterfly, and The 极乐禁地e Scene, organized by Chin-Yer Wright, as well as poetry circles organized in labor unions, local record labels and poetry journals, and the many poetry series and open mics鈥攁ll of which lift up poetry as a spectrum.

Values and
Guiding Principles

We value the multiple ways that people approach their art equally; no particular type of poetry is elevated over another.

We recognize that, historically, some people and poetries have been marginalized and denied access to resources. And all have been separated into camps, such that the literary community鈥檚 aesthetic variety and diversity is impinged by a lack of social overlap. We believe that creatives should be paid for their work.

We hope to strengthen and bolster the entire arts and culture ecosystem. To cultivate shared humanity and a stronger, more inclusive community.

We understand a Poet Laureate to be an ambassador to the city, and as such is accountable to the whole city, not just their part of the city, their politics, or their aesthetic tradition.

 

Poets to Watch

极乐禁地e-area poets that bring the scence alive.

Ken Brown is a performing artist, writer, minister, bookseller with more than 20 years experience in transformational education and ministry, dissemination of information and dynamic performing arts performance looking for performance and speaking/consulting opportunities.

Olu Butterfly is a village builder, Olu Butterfly Woods is a social entrepreneur, applied afrofuturist and distinctive artist who has founded several long running, impactful 极乐禁地e initiatives: The Garden Art Party, Afrikan Youth Alchemy, Free Up Village CSE, 极乐禁地e Citywide Youth Poetry Team, Organic Soul Tuesdays and Poetry for the People 极乐禁地e.

Jo毛l Diaz is a writer, educator, and steward for arts and culture with a vested interest in storytelling, community building, and creative placemaking. He has garnered leadership expertise in arts administration, public programming, publishing, and non-profit management, helping organizations champion artists and expand community access to the arts.

 

Carla Du Pree is an author who writes fiction and also serves as an arts ambassador, a literary consultant, the executive director of an award-winning, nonprofit CityLit Project, and a national advocate of the literary arts.

Keegan Cook Finberg is an assistant professor of English at UMBC. She is also affiliate faculty in the departments of Gender, Women鈥檚, + Sexuality Studies and Language, Literacy, and Culture at UMBC. She is currently at work on a book about the politics of post-1960s poetry in the United States.

Lady Brion is an international spoken word artist, poetry coach, activist, organizer, educator, the executive director of the Pennsylvania Avenue Black Arts and Entertainment District and the 11th Poet Laureate of Maryland.

Ailish Hopper is a poet, writer, and multidisciplinary artist. She teaches at Goucher College.

Jeannie L. Howe is the Executive Director of the Greater 极乐禁地e Cultural Alliance, a regional, membership organization that was organized by artists and cultural organizations to unify, nurture and promote the cultural sector in 极乐禁地e and its five surrounding counties.

Eze Jackson is a rapper, songwriter, producer, and organizer. He is a founder at EPIC FAM, MC/frontman at Soul Cannon, former Petty Officer 2nd Class (E-5) in the United States Navy, and former host and producer at The Real News Network.

Steven Leyva is a Cave Canem fellow and author of the chapbook Low Parish and author of The Understudy's Handbook which won the Jean Feldman Poetry Prize from Washington Writers Publishing House. His second book of poems, The Opposite of Cruelty, was published by Blair Publishing in March 2025. He teaches in the Creative Writing & Publishing Arts MFA program at The 极乐禁地.

Dora Malech is the author of four books of poetry, Flourish (Carnegie Mellon University Press, 2020), Stet (Princeton University Press, 2018), Say So (Cleveland State University Poetry Center, 2011) and Shore Ordered Ocean (The Waywiser Press, 2009). With Laura T. Smith, she edited The American Sonnet: An Anthology of Poems and Essays, published by the University of Iowa Press in 2023. She teaches in the Writing Seminars at Johns Hopkins University.

Jenn茅 Afiya Matthews is a multidisciplinary creative, grown and honed in 极乐禁地e. She is the founding member of BALTI GURLS, a Black queer woman and femme-led artist collective established in 2014. In the years since, she has garnered acclaim across the film, community programming, and brand strategy industries, working and collaborating with BLACK MATTER, Luminal Theater, BlackStar Projects, Black Femme Supremacy Film Festival, and Retrospect Studios. She is also the creator and host of ZUZU HAUS, an audio project dedicated to exploring the unique relationship Black folks have with their home spaces, past and present.

Kenneth is an artist, organizer and educator from 极乐禁地e, Maryland. For over a decade, Kenneth has worked to create art and institutions that connect and transform people. Most recently, his work centers around marginalized people gaining access to their intellectual, emotional, spiritual and creative traditions. Some of Kenneth's most notable accomplishments include being a father, a national poetry slam champion, the founder of DewMore 极乐禁地e, former executive director of Pride Center of Maryland, professor at MICA, co-chair for 极乐禁地e Blaq Pride, program director of Black Arts District, and founder and director of Charm City Slam.

Jessica "Jess" Solomon (she/her) is an organizational development practitioner and coach dedicated to designing and facilitating transformative experiences that harness collective wisdom and creativity in how groups address challenges, devise solutions, and build culture. She collaborates with systems change and social justice leaders as a strategic adviser and thought partner.
